Hi, I just bought a used Rx5700XT Taichi OC. It has a massive cooler and is supposed to run at about 75c @100% utilization. Instead, it is running at 102 degrees C at 100% utilization. It isn't very dusty, the drivers are up to date, and my side panel is off. It is currently 71 degrees F in my house. What do you suggest that I do?

Have you disassembled it and re-pasted it?
Maybe the thermal paste is wicked old, or the person who sold it to you just cleaned it up for it to look good and forgot to add the thermal paste. I'd rule that out before continuing with any other testing.
